Abstract
A method of producing a catalyst comprising: mixing catalytic particles and a solvent, thereby forming a mixture; performing a size distribution analysis on the mixture to determine a size distribution profile; repeating the mixing of the catalytic particles and the solvent in the mixture if the size distribution profile is below a threshold; centrifuging the mixture if the size distribution profile is at or above the threshold, thereby forming a supernate and a precipitate, wherein the supernate comprises a dispersion including the catalytic particles and the solvent; decanting the mixture, separating the supernate from the precipitate; determining the particle content of the separated supernate; determining a volume of the dispersion to be applied to a catalyst support based on one or more properties of the catalyst support; and impregnating the catalyst support with the catalytic particles in the dispersion by applying the volume of the dispersion to the catalyst support.
